Major United States Property Developers

The United States has one of the world's largest and most diverse real estate development markets. Leading developers operate across residential communities, condominiums, mixed-use projects, commercial assets, and large-scale master-planned communities.

Developer Main Sector Key Regions
Lennar Residential Communities, Single-Family Homes, Multifamily Nationwide USA
D.R. Horton Single-Family Residential Development Major Markets Across USA
PulteGroup Residential Communities, Active Adult Housing USA Sun Belt, Southeast, Southwest
Toll Brothers Luxury Homes, Residential Communities USA Luxury Markets
Related Companies Luxury Residential, Mixed-Use, Urban Development New York, Florida, California, Major Cities
Brookfield Properties Commercial, Mixed-Use, Residential North America / Major US Cities
Hines Commercial Real Estate, Residential, Mixed-Use Global / Major US Metropolitan Areas
Sekisui House Residential Communities, Housing Development United States Growth Markets
American Homes 4 Rent Build-to-Rent Communities Sun Belt States
Greystar Multifamily Apartments, Rental Communities Nationwide USA

What Makes a Developer One of the Largest?

Size is not determined by a single measurement. Some companies build the highest number of residential homes each year, while others are recognised for delivering major commercial developments or large mixed use destinations.

Several factors contribute to a developer's market position, including the number of completed projects, geographic reach, development pipeline, land holdings, financial strength and long-term industry presence.

Many of the country's largest developers have been operating for decades and continue to expand into new markets as population and economic growth create fresh development opportunities.

National Reach and Regional Expertise

Large developers often operate nationally while maintaining strong regional teams that understand local planning regulations, infrastructure requirements and housing demand.

This combination allows major companies to deliver projects across states such as Florida, Texas, California, Arizona, Colorado and North Carolina while adapting their developments to local market conditions.

Regional expertise remains important even for nationally recognised organisations because every property market has different planning policies, demographic trends and economic drivers.

Residential Development Leaders

Many of America's largest developers are best known for creating residential communities. These companies build thousands of homes annually, ranging from entry-level housing and suburban neighbourhoods to luxury residences and age-restricted communities.

Large residential developers often specialise in long-term land acquisition and phased construction programmes that can continue for many years as communities expand.

Commercial Development Leaders

The country's largest commercial developers create office buildings, retail centres, logistics parks, industrial facilities and hospitality projects that support business growth across the United States.

Many of these organisations work closely with local authorities, infrastructure providers and institutional investors on developments that become important economic centres within their regions.

Commercial property companies frequently manage large, complex projects requiring long-term planning and substantial investment.

Mixed Use and Master Planned Communities

Some of the nation's largest developers have become recognised for creating complete communities rather than individual buildings.

Mixed use developments combine residential property, offices, retail, restaurants, hotels and public spaces into integrated destinations, while master planned communities deliver entire neighbourhoods complete with schools, parks, healthcare facilities and supporting infrastructure.

These large-scale developments often take many years to complete and require significant long-term planning.
